Regulatory Signs
Stop. Yield. No Parking. Regulatory signs are the law on display, ensuring drivers know exactly what’s expected. Whether it’s managing high-traffic areas like Crow Canyon Road or enforcing “No Parking” zones near Bishop Ranch, these signs are non-negotiable.
Crafted with precision, regulatory signs rely on high-contrast designs for maximum visibility. Materials like reflective aluminum make sure they’re seen—rain or shine, day or night. But a poorly maintained or outdated sign? That’s a recipe for accidents and confusion. Warning Signs
San Ramon’s hilly terrain and winding roads make warning signs a must. From “Sharp Turn Ahead” to pedestrian crossing alerts near San Ramon Valley High, these signs save lives by giving drivers time to react.
Bright yellow and universally recognizable, warning signs demand attention. But their job isn’t just to stand out—it’s to guide. Think of slippery-road signs during a rare Bay Area rain or construction zone warnings on Bollinger Canyon Road. Every detail, from the font to the placement, matters when safety is on the line. Construction Signs
Construction zones can be hectic, but well-placed signs bring order to the chaos. Whether it’s “Detour” arrows on Camino Ramon or “Road Closed” warnings on Alcosta Boulevard, these signs protect both workers and drivers.
Bright orange with bold black text, construction signs are impossible to miss. But their placement and durability are just as important as their design. Temporary signs need to withstand unpredictable weather and constant handling, and we make sure they’re up to the task.
